The final week! I had a great time with my project this week. The beginning of the week consisted odf a lot of weeding and plot clean up in preparation for the tea open house that happened Saturday June 12. On Tuesday, I spent my time clearing tea plant debris from the mother plot. Kacie and Gavin decided to prune the entire top half of the whole tea field on this day so I was in charge of clearing away all of the trimmings from the tops of the plants and making sure they weren't blocking the tea plants from getting sun or anything else important. I also did a little weeding on Tuesday. On Wednesday, Ayla accompanied me to the farm and we spent the whole morning weeding a new plot that is much smaller. The thistles were so so overgrown that there was more weeds than actual tea plants! After weeding all morning and having lunch, we then spent the rest of the afternoon packaging the final product tea for the open house.
